THE STORY OF INCEPTION OF SHAFA
A Vision That Changed Addiction Treatment
SHAFA was founded on 22nd November 1999 with a singular vision—to transform the way addiction treatment was delivered in India. Guided by the leadership and expertise of
Mr. Ranjan Dhar, and supported by a dedicated group of recovering individuals, SHAFA was established to help people overcome drug and alcohol addiction through complete physical, emotional, psychological, and spiritual healing.
At a time when most de-addiction programs focused primarily on detoxification and managing withdrawal symptoms, SHAFA introduced a revolutionary approach. As one of India's first Therapeutic Community (TC) rehabilitation centres, it shifted the focus from simply treating symptoms to addressing the underlying causes of addiction. Rather than relying on substitute mood-altering substances, the program emphasised personal responsibility, behavioural change, peer support, and long-term recovery.
This pioneering "bio-psycho-social-spiritual" model redefined addiction treatment in the country and laid the foundation for a recovery movement that has transformed thousands of lives. Over the years, SHAFA has grown into one of India's most respected rehabilitation centres, while remaining true to the values on which it was founded—compassion, integrity, accountability, and the unwavering belief that every individual deserves a second chance.

Mission
Shafa is an Urdu word that means "the power of healing." Built upon one of the oldest and most effective models of recovery, Shafa Home is a non-profit organization that serves as a beacon of hope, self-discovery, and lasting happiness for hundreds of individuals recovering from alcohol and drug dependence.
Guided by our mission, "Healing the Feeling, Feeling the Healing," we go beyond traditional approaches to treating addiction and behavioral disorders by incorporating well-researched, evidence-based healing methods that address the mind, body, and spirit.
Our dedicated team is made up of volunteers who have successfully completed treatment at Shafa and have firsthand experience in recovery. Their personal journeys, combined with specialized training, enable them to understand the complexities of addiction with empathy and insight.
